Bridge 桥模式
动机 由于某些类型的固有实现逻辑,使得他们具有两个变化维度,乃至多个变化维度的变化。 如何应对这种“ …
动机 由于某些类型的固有实现逻辑,使得他们具有两个变化维度,乃至多个变化维度的变化。 如何应对这种“ …
动机 在某些情况下我们可能会“过度的使用继承来扩展对象功能”,由于继承为类型引入的静态特质,使得这种 …
动机 在软件构建过程中,我们需要为某些对象建立一种“通知依赖关系”—–一个对 …
动机 在软件构建过程中,某些对象使用的算法可能多种多样,经常改变,如果将这些算法都编码到对象中,将会 …
动机 在软件构建过程中,对于某一项任务,它常常有稳定的整体操作结构,但各个子步骤却有很多改变的需求, …
1 什么是设计模式 “每一个模式描述了一个在我们周围不断重复发生的问题,以及该问题的解决方案的核心。 …